After My Alpha Humiliated Me, I Awakened as Royalty Chapter 1

The bond broke at 11:47 on a Thursday night.

I felt it before Dallas finished the last word. The mate mark on the left side of my neck—the one he'd pressed his teeth into three years ago in front of his pack, the one I'd touched every morning since like a compass—went cold. Not gradually. All at once, like a door slamming shut in an empty room.

I was standing in the great hall of the Ashvale Pack house. Thirty wolves behind me, every one of them silent. Dallas stood on the raised platform where he gave pack announcements, and in his right hand he held a carved piece of bone no longer than my forearm. He'd found it in the vault that afternoon. He'd come to me first, actually—eyes bright, voice tight with the specific excitement of a man who believes he's finally found his shortcut. *It's an ancient Alpha relic, Vivian. Lycan-level power, locked in the bloodline of whoever carries it.*

I'd looked at the carving and felt something cold move through me that had nothing to do with the bone itself.

Now he was speaking the formal words.

"I, Dallas Carr, Alpha of the Ashvale Pack, reject you, Vivian Bradley, Omega of the Ashvale Pack, as my mate."

The cold spread from my neck down my spine. My ribs—

Something hit me from the inside. Not a blow. A shattering. Like a fist slamming against a sealed door in the deepest part of my chest. Two of my ribs cracked with a sound I felt rather than heard, and I folded forward at the waist, one hand going to the stone floor before I could stop it.

No one moved to catch me.

From somewhere very far below the pain, a voice I had never heard before said, clearly and without inflection: *He will regret this.*

My wolf. For the first and only time, before going silent again like a candle snuffed in a sealed room.

I pressed my palm flat against the cold stone and pushed myself upright. My legs shook. My ribs screamed. I kept my face still.

Dallas was already stepping down from the platform, the bone carving tucked under his arm like a prize. He didn't look at me.

None of them did.

---

I found out about the pendant an hour later.

I went back to the Alpha suite because my healer's kit was there. I needed to wrap my ribs before the internal bleeding got worse, and I was not going to ask anyone in that hall for help. The suite door was unlocked. I pushed it open.

Amanda was sitting up in Dallas's bed, the sheet pooled at her waist, wearing my mother's silver pendant at the hollow of her throat.

She looked at me the way you look at someone who has arrived at the wrong party.

Dallas was behind me before I could speak. I felt his Alpha tone hit me like a hand pressing down on the back of my neck—involuntary, biological, the kind of command that bypasses thought entirely.

"Kneel."

My knees bent. I locked them. It cost me something I don't have a name for, fighting that tone with two cracked ribs and a severed bond still bleeding through my chest, but I stayed standing.

Amanda reached up without hurry, unclasped the pendant's chain, and dropped it into the lit fireplace beside the bed. She held my gaze the entire time.

The silver caught. Melted. Gone.

I did not scream. I did not beg. I turned around and walked out.

---

In the morning I stood in the great hall again and spoke my own formal words.

"I, Vivian Bradley, accept the rejection of Dallas Carr, Alpha of the Ashvale Pack."

Dallas waved a hand toward his Beta to handle the settlement. Standard Omega severance—a small sum, a week's food allocation, escort to the pack border.

"I want the eastern territory," I said.

Silence. Then a few muffled sounds that were almost laughter.

The eastern territory was forty acres of windswept scrubland on the pack's outer boundary. Rocky soil. No structures. No water source anyone had bothered to map. Dallas had mentioned it twice in five years, both times as an example of worthless land.

"Fine," he said, and smiled like I'd just asked for the broken chair in the storage room.

I had memorized the boundary coordinates two years ago, during a routine administrative audit I'd run alone because Dallas couldn't be bothered. I knew exactly what sat on the eastern edge of that territory. Dallas did not.

I walked out of the Ashvale Pack house with the braided cord on my left wrist where my mother's pendant used to rest at night, the coordinates locked behind my eyes, and nothing else.

---

Three days later, a lean man in a grey jacket found me on the eastern boundary and offered me a water skin without a word. We stood in the wind for ten full minutes before he spoke.

"Your scent carries the bloodline signature of Lycan King Marvin's lost daughter," he said. "I am his Beta. He has been searching for twenty-five years."

I asked him three questions. He answered each one without softening a syllable.

I handed back the water skin and said, "When do we leave?"
